Technical Considerations for 451 38 Round Compositions

Shooting for the 451 38 blognobon round face format requires attention to sensor resolution, lens compression, and lighting direction. Mid-telephoto lenses around 85mm to 105mm on full-frame cameras help minimize facial distortion while preserving natural proportions at close distances.

Post-processing workflows typically involve subtle skin smoothing, precise circular cropping, and controlled vignetting to guide the viewer’s eye toward the center. Maintaining highlight detail and avoiding over-smoothing ensures that portraits remain authentic and visually engaging.

How can I maintain consistent lighting across a series of round face images?

Use fixed lighting positions, a light meter or reference shots, and preset editing profiles to preserve uniform brightness, contrast, and mood across the series.

What camera settings work best for minimizing distortion in 451 38 round face shots?

Choose a mid-range telephoto lens, shoot at a slightly farther distance with a moderate aperture (f/2.8–f/4), and avoid extreme wide-angle perspectives to keep facial features natural.
